Rajiv Sharma, J.
This Regular Second Appeal is directed against the judgment and decree, dated 16.10.2004, passed by the learned District Judge, Kullu, District Kullu, H.P. in Civil Appeal No. 08/04.
2. Key facts necessary for the adjudication of this Regular Second Appeal are that the appellants-plaintiffs (hereinafter referred to as “the plaintiffs” for the sake of convenience) had instituted a suit for permanent prohibitory injunction restraining the respondents-defendants (hereinafter referred to as 'the defendants' for the sake of convenience) from interfering or changing the nature of the land comprised in Khata Khatauni No. 113/143 min, Khasra Nos. 1737 and 1738, Kita 2, measuring 6140 bighas, situated in Phati and Kothi Bhallan, Tehsil and District Kullu. Plaintiffs have raised an apple orchard over the suit property and the defendants were strangers. The defendants have direct approach to their land from Khasra No. 1740 for carrying out agricultural operation and path passes through Government land and one path goes from village Ruar to village Narol. The defendants were requested to desist from the unlawful activities, but they refused.
